Emerald Management 175 and Engineering Journals


Emerald Management 175 combines the Emerald Fulltext database with Emerald Management Reviews through an integrated search and navigation system, providing access to 170 authoritative management titles, 76% of which are peer-reviewed.

IReL also has access to the Emerald Engineering eJournal Collection which gives online access to the full text of all 23 journals (4 of which are common to Em. Management 175 ) within Emerald's engineering, materials science and technology portfolio.
